Overview

The Fisherman and his WifeA fisherman finds a magic fish. The fisherman's wife wants a cottage. The fisherman asks the fish and they have it. A week later she wants a house. A week later she wants a palace and she wants to be Queen. The fisherman's wife cannot be happy. She wants to be Emperor of all the world. The Ugly DucklingThe ugly duckling runs away from the farm. He runs away from men with guns and dogs to an old hut. He hasn't got any eggs, so he must go. In the winter he's cold and he can't swim. Poor ugly duckling! Nobody likes him. In the spring he flies down to a river and sees his face in the water. He's not an ugly duckling any more!
